On May 30th, last Saturday, I got a chance to launch my first book, Gerbang Nuswantara. I just knew recently that not all writers have a chance to have his/her book launched officially and being covered by the press, so I felt very lucky to get the publisher that fully support my book and prepare the launching event, finding me the best speaker and moderator that made the event went merry yet relaxed.

At 2 p.m., Gramedia Grand Indonesia, East Mall Level 2, was started to crowded with visitors, and some were sitting nicely on the seats prepared by the bookstore. I got some important guests that made me feel honored with their visit: Mr. Harry Soejono, Mr. Andris Halim (author of Cakrapolis comics), Mr. Nuranto (Tembi Yogya) and family, Mr. Anton (Tembi Yogya) and family, also Mr. Stanley Harsha (author of "Like the Moon and the Sun"--whose book just released and launched last month) and wife. Finally all the performers arrived and the event began--started with the book launching. The publisher gave the book symbollicly to me, represented by my editor, Mr. Mahatma Chrysna. After that, Mr. Danie Satrio (chief editor of Hai Magazine) as moderator of Book Review; Ms. Dhea Seto (young dancer & artist) and also Mr. Arswendo Atmowiloto (writer & humanist) as speakers sat next to me. I just met them in persons on the day, without any chit-chat or approach before. The truth is, I felt a little groggy. But Mr. Satrio calmed me, asked questions to the speakers that made me both relaxed and amazed listening to their answers.


One curiosity that came from Mr. Atmowiloto was the fact that he had read my book before, with a precise details that he couldn't got it from other book--some kind of déjà vu, perhaps. And he remembers the plot, the characters to a certain page. "It's the power of art," he answered when he was asked about the legitimation of the literature references I used. I felt so honored to see how Mr. Atmowiloto liked the story and the message I delivered thru the book.

Dhea Seto claimed another thing about her interest on this book, as one of very few books she could finish reading. I felt very flattered by the fact that she impregnated my book so much, that she considered to have everything from the culture and ethics to math formulas. I was touched when Dhea praised the book honestly because she was not told or paid but she really felt a connection with Rani's character and there were some similarities between what her dancing instructor said about our nation with what I wrote in this book.
